    Introduction Human rights‚ the inalienable rights and freedoms to which all humans are entitled[1] need constant protection. The human rights protection in the Australian law is not offered by either a constitutional or statutory Bill of Rights‚ but a collection of various legislation and court judgments. Thus‚ the role of the judiciary or the court systems in the human rights protection in individual cases becomes especially vital.     Sex trafficking is a terrible widespread phenomenon in the United States. Human trafficking ranks 3rd in world crime. An U.N. agency estimated the total value of human trafficking at $150 billion. (Tampa bay times) The Government Accountability Office wrote that "human trafficking involves the exploitation of a person typically through force‚ fraud for the purpose of forced labor‚ involuntary servitude or commercial sex." Desperate people might go into debt to smugglers who place them in jobs.
